So, just an update on this.
After yanking the roof rack off and seeing how bad it was (and getting the stellar RDP advice here ) I was like, "FUCK!" I put the rack back on and siliconed the edges hoping it wouldn't leak for now while I decided what to do.
Checked a couple body shops for quotes. I was getting quotes for 5k-7k to cut out metal or even entire roof to replace. Or 2k-3k to do the bondo type thing which would only last a couple years. Buddy owns a dealer / shop and said he could do it maaaaaaaybe as low as 1500 for the bondo / fiberglass crap but advised me to sell it. He also had a pretty nice 17 Escalade on his lot I was thinking of trading in for but I seriously don't want car payments. This Yukon only has 80k miles and every option 4wd 2500. Love the thing. No payment. Really don't want to get rid of it. Especially when we put like 4k miles a year on it.
